Barcodes are just plain text using a Barcode font. The fonts you can try from www.dobsonsw.com from where you can download the zipped 128 fonts. After downloading and unzipping, copy the two .ttf files into C:\Windows\Fonts.




After done you can now use the two true type fonts (TTF) using MS Word.



You can see from above that the two fonts are now under the list of fonts. MS Office programs use the C:\Windows\Fonts to generate the choices of fonts for MS Word. If you want to add any font, make sure the font file is in the directory shown below:
